- Wynn Resorts (NASDAQ:WYNN) announces Macau revenue fell 35.8% in Q2.
- The table games turnover in the Macau VIP segment fell 41.1%, while the table games win percentage was 2.7%. The Macau slots handle and win both fell sharply as well.
- The table game win percentage in Vegas was 19.5% vs. 21%-24% expected and 27.4% a year ago.
- Las Vegas revenue -6.2% to $423.5M.
- REVPAR in Macau -5.8% to $310.
- REVPAR in Vegas +1.6% to $255.
- Total cash at the end of the quarter was $1.8B. Outstanding debt was reported to be $8.1B.
